Central Maine Healthcare (CMH), a member of Prime Healthcare Foundation, is an integrated healthcare delivery system serving approximately 400,000 residents across central, western, and midcoast Maine through a network of more than 40 primary and specialty care locations. The system includes Central Maine Medical Center (CMMC) in Lewiston, a 250-bed, not-for-profit regional referral hospital that is home to the region's only Cancer Care Center, an orthopedic ambulatory surgery center, and the Central Maine Heart and Vascular Institute. CMMC also serves as the central Maine base for LifeFlight of Maine, the state's only medical helicopter service.
CMH also includes Bridgton Hospital and Rumford Hospital, two 25-bed critical access hospitals that provide essential care to Maine's rural communities.
As part of its commitment to healthcare education and workforce development, CMH is home to the Maine College of Health Professions, Maine's first nursing and medical imaging school. The private, not-for-profit institution is accredited by the New England Commission of Higher Education and plays an important role in training the next generation of healthcare professionals.

Provides medically prescribed physical therapy services to evaluate, treat, and restore function while improving mobility, reducing pain, and preventing disability. Delivers patient-centered care in accordance with hospital policies, regulatory requirements, and evidence-based practices.
• Perform patient evaluations and physical therapy assessments
• Develop and implement individualized treatment plans
• Provide therapeutic interventions for rehabilitation and functional improvement
• Monitor patient progress and adjust treatment plans as needed
• Educate patients and families on treatment plans and recovery goals
• Document evaluations, treatments, and patient outcomes accurately
• Collaborate with physicians and interdisciplinary healthcare teams
• Maintain compliance with regulatory, licensing, and patient safety standards
EDUCATION, EXPERIENCE, TRAINING
1. Bachelor/ Masters/ Doctorate/Certificate degree in Physical Therapy
2. Current state Physical Therapy license
3. Current BCLS (AHA) certificate upon hire and maintain current.
